If you love nutty, rich, and irresistibly smooth frozen treats, then you are going to fall head over heels for this Creamy Pistachio Ice Cream Recipe. This delightful dessert combines the natural buttery flavor of pistachios with the lushness of cream and a hint of vanilla, creating a luxurious texture that feels like a dream on your tongue. Perfect for warm afternoons or a special dinner finale, it’s a recipe that’s as beautiful to look at as it is to savor.

Ingredients You’ll Need
The magic of this ice cream starts with just a handful of simple yet essential ingredients. Each one plays a vital role in building that perfect balance of texture, flavor, and creaminess that makes this recipe truly special.
- 1 cup shelled pistachios: Provides the signature nutty taste and green color, plus a nice crunch when chopped lightly.
- 2 cups heavy cream: Adds the luscious creaminess that makes this ice cream so smooth and rich.
- 1 cup whole milk: Balances the cream to lighten the texture just enough without sacrificing richness.
- 3/4 cup granulated sugar: Sweetens the ice cream perfectly while helping with the scoopable texture.
- 1 teaspoon vanilla extract: Enhances the nutty flavor with a warm, subtle aroma.
- 1/4 teaspoon almond extract (optional): Adds a delicate complement to the pistachio’s earthiness if you want a little extra depth.
- A pinch of salt: Elevates all the flavors and balances the sweetness beautifully.
- A few drops of green food coloring (optional): Makes the ice cream beautifully vibrant, just like your favorite ice cream shop’s version.
How to Make Creamy Pistachio Ice Cream Recipe
Step 1: Prepare the Pistachios
Start by finely chopping the pistachios in a food processor until they become almost a paste, but still keep some small chunks for delightful texture contrast in the ice cream. This step unlocks their oils and maximum flavor, laying the great foundation for the entire recipe.
Step 2: Heat the Dairy and Sugar
In a medium saucepan, combine the heavy cream, whole milk, and granulated sugar. Warm the mixture over medium heat, stirring gently until all the sugar has completely dissolved. Be careful not to let it boil; you just want a smooth, sweetened liquid to infuse with pistachio goodness.
Step 3: Mix in Flavors
Once the sugar is dissolved, remove the pan from the heat and stir in your chopped pistachios, vanilla extract, optional almond extract, and a pinch of salt. If you choose to add green food coloring, now’s the moment to mix it in evenly, watching as the pale cream transforms into a gorgeous shade of green.
Step 4: Chill the Mixture
Allow the mixture to cool down to room temperature. Then, cover and refrigerate it for at least 4 hours or, even better, overnight. This chilling time lets the flavors blend and the liquid become perfectly cold for churning into ice cream.
Step 5: Churn to Perfection
Pour the chilled mixture into your ice cream maker and churn according to your machine’s instructions until it reaches a soft-serve texture. This step is where your Creamy Pistachio Ice Cream Recipe really starts to take shape — that luscious, creamy consistency you’re aiming for.
Step 6: Freeze Until Firm
Transfer the churned ice cream to a freezer-safe container and cover it tightly. Freeze for at least 2 hours, allowing the ice cream to set firmly. When ready, scoop it up and enjoy the fruits of your labor, garnished with some extra chopped pistachios for crunch and color.
How to Serve Creamy Pistachio Ice Cream Recipe

Garnishes
Simple garnishes can elevate your pistachio ice cream to elegant dessert status in seconds. Sprinkle extra chopped pistachios on top for added texture and visual appeal, or drizzle a little honey or chocolate sauce to complement the nutty flavor beautifully.
Side Dishes
This ice cream pairs wonderfully with light, fruity sides like fresh berries or poached pears. You can also serve it alongside a warm almond biscotti or a delicate pistachio cookie for a lovely contrast of textures and temperatures.
Creative Ways to Present
For a playful presentation, try scooping the Creamy Pistachio Ice Cream Recipe into mini waffle cones or hollowed-out pistachio shells. You can also layer it into parfait glasses with chopped nuts and whipped cream for a stunning visual treat that tastes as good as it looks.
Make Ahead and Storage
Storing Leftovers
If you find yourself with leftovers, storing your pistachio ice cream properly is key to maintaining its creamy texture and flavor. Use an airtight container and press a piece of parchment paper directly onto the surface to prevent ice crystals from forming.
Freezing
The ice cream will keep well in the freezer for up to two weeks. Just remember to let it sit at room temperature for a few minutes before scooping so it softens just enough for easy serving without losing its silky consistency.
Reheating
Ice cream isn’t typically reheated, but if it becomes too hard, allowing it to gently thaw in the refrigerator for 20 to 30 minutes works best. Avoid microwaving as it can alter the texture and melt unevenly, ruining the creamy pleasure.
FAQs
Can I make this recipe without an ice cream maker?
Yes! You can pour the mixture into a shallow container, freeze it, and stir every 30 minutes to break up ice crystals until creamy. It takes longer, but you’ll still get delicious results.
Are there vegan alternatives for this Creamy Pistachio Ice Cream Recipe?
Absolutely. You can substitute the dairy with coconut milk or almond milk and use a sweetener like agave or maple syrup to keep it plant-based while maintaining a rich texture.
Why add almond extract? Is it necessary?
The almond extract adds a subtle complementary note to the pistachios but is completely optional. Without it, the ice cream will still taste wonderful with just the vanilla and nut flavors shining through.
Can I use unshelled pistachios?
It’s best to use shelled pistachios to avoid a tough, gritty texture in your ice cream. If you only have unshelled, make sure to remove all shells carefully before processing.
How can I get bright green pistachio ice cream naturally?
Natural pistachio green is often subtle. For a more vivid color, you can add a few drops of green food coloring as in this recipe. Alternatively, using pistachio paste sometimes yields a stronger hue.
Final Thoughts
Making this Creamy Pistachio Ice Cream Recipe at home is truly a rewarding experience that brings an indulgent, nutty delight to your dessert table. Whether you’re treating yourself on a sunny afternoon or impressing guests with a homemade classic, this recipe offers both simplicity and elegance in every luscious spoonful. Give it a try—you’ll wonder why you didn’t whip up this creamy dream sooner!
Print
Creamy Pistachio Ice Cream Recipe
- Prep Time: 20 minutes
- Cook Time: 10 minutes
- Total Time: 6 hours 30 minutes
- Yield: 4 to 6 servings
- Category: Dessert
- Method: Stovetop
- Cuisine: American
Description
This creamy Pistachio Ice Cream recipe is rich, nutty, and perfect for a refreshing homemade treat. Made with finely chopped pistachios, creamy milk and heavy cream, and subtly flavored with vanilla and almond extracts, it offers a luscious texture and vibrant pistachio flavor. Ideal for dessert lovers looking to indulge in a classic, nutty ice cream made from scratch.
Ingredients
Ice Cream Base
- 1 cup shelled pistachios (plus extra for garnish)
- 2 cups heavy cream
- 1 cup whole milk
- 3/4 cup granulated sugar
- 1 teaspoon vanilla extract
- 1/4 teaspoon almond extract (optional)
- A pinch of salt
- A few drops of green food coloring (optional, for a vibrant color)
Instructions
- Prepare Pistachios: Finely chop the pistachios in a food processor until they are almost a paste but still have some small chunks for added texture, ensuring a rich pistachio flavor in every bite.
- Heat Cream Mixture: In a medium saucepan, combine the heavy cream, whole milk, and granulated sugar. Heat the mixture over medium heat, stirring constantly until the sugar dissolves completely. Do not let it boil. Once heated, remove from heat and stir in the chopped pistachios, vanilla extract, almond extract if using, and a pinch of salt. For a vibrant color, add a few drops of green food coloring and mix well.
- Chill the Mixture: Allow the pistachio cream mixture to cool down to room temperature. Then cover and refrigerate it for at least 4 hours or preferably overnight to enhance the flavors and ensure a creamy texture.
- Churn the Ice Cream: Pour the chilled mixture into your ice cream maker and churn according to the manufacturer’s instructions until it reaches a soft-serve consistency, typically around 20-30 minutes depending on your machine.
- Freeze Until Firm: Transfer the churned ice cream into a freezer-safe container, cover tightly, and freeze for at least 2 hours to let the ice cream firm up. Serve scooped into bowls or cones, garnished with extra chopped pistachios for a delightful crunch.
Notes
- If you prefer a smoother texture, pulse the pistachios more finely but leave some small chunks for added bite.
- Green food coloring is optional but can enhance the ice cream’s visual appeal.
- For a more intense pistachio flavor, you can toast the pistachios lightly before chopping.
- If you don’t have an ice cream maker, you can pour the mixture into a shallow container and freeze, stirring every 30 minutes until firm to mimic churning.
- Store leftovers in an airtight container to prevent freezer burn and maintain freshness.

